Warning Signs You Need Laminate Floor Water Extraction

Ignoring warning signs can lead to costly repairs and even health risks. Our team is here to help you identify the signs of water damage and prevent further complications.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, persistent odors can show the presence of bacteria, mold, or mildew. If you notice a musty smell in your home, it’s essential to investigate and address the issue quickly.

Warped or Buckled Laminate Floors

Water damage can cause laminate floors to warp or buckle, creating an uneven surface and potentially leading to further damage.

Stains or Discoloration

Stains or discoloration on your laminate floors can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any changes in the color or texture of your floors, it’s crucial to investigate and address the issue quickly.

Peeling or Flaking Paint

Water damage can cause paint to peel or flake, creating an eyesore and potentially leading to further damage.

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ls

Water stains on ceilings or walls can show a more significant issue, such as a leaky roof or pipe. If you notice any water stains, it’s essential to investigate and address the issue quickly.

Soft or Spongy Floors

Water damage can cause laminate floors to become soft or spongy, creating an uneven surface and potentially leading to further damage.

Laminate Floor Water Extraction Cost in Bailey, CO

The cost of Laminate Floor Water Extraction services in Bailey, CO can vary depending on the severity, size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team provides free estimates for all our services, and we’ll work with you to develop a customized solution that meets your needs and budget.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water removal and extraction $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of water damage
Drying and dehumidification $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, severity of water damage
Sanitizing and disinfecting $100 – $500 Size of affected area, severity of water damage
Restoration and repair $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, severity of water damage, type of materials used

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ment and consultation with our team. We’re happy to provide a free estimate and help you develop a customized solution that meets your needs and budget.
